The Shifting Weather Patterns

Weather forecasts are showcasing a substantial shift with maps turning purple and white, which typically denote cold and stormy weather. According to data forecasts from WXCharts, in partnership with MetDesk, a significant portion of the UK is predicted to experience rain, snow, or a mix of both, primarily pushing in from the east. But what exactly can we expect?

The Timing of the Storms

Mark your calendars as early as midnight on Tuesday, May 6, the weather will take a turn for the colder. Scotland is set to bear the brunt of the snowfall, but the icy grip of winter won't stop there—expect it to spill down into northern regions of England as well. Cities like Manchester, Newcastle, and even parts of the Midlands, including Birmingham, aren't going to escape the drenching rainfall that looms on the horizon.

Preparing for the Weather Ahead

Preparation is the key to weathering any storm. Here are a few simple tips to ensure you’re ready for whatever May throws your way:

  • Stay Informed: Keep your weather apps updated and check local news for the latest forecasts.
  • Check Your Heating System: Ensure everything is in working order, especially as temperatures drop.
  • Stock Up on Supplies: Make sure your pantry is stocked with essentials in case you’re unable to go out.
  • Safety First: Be prepared for potential power outages with flashlights and candles.
  • Travel Wisely: If you have to go out, keep abreast of road conditions and allow extra time for travel.
